What companies run services between Turin, Italy and Pontida, Italy?

You can take a train from Torino Porta Susa to Pontida via Milano Centrale and Lecco in around 3h 15m. Alternatively, FlixBus operates a bus from Turin to Bergamo every 4 hours. Tickets cost €11–20 and the journey takes 2h 50m. BlaBlaCar Bus also services this route 4 times a week.
